Customs seize cigarettes and hookah tobacco at Deryneia crossing

Deryneia, Cyprus. Customs officers seized cigarettes and hookah tobacco during routine checks at the Deryneia crossing point on Wednesday, imposing out-of-court fines in two separate cases.


Cigarettes seized from vehicle

In the first case, officers stopped a vehicle driven by a 46-year-old Hungarian national and found 59 boxes containing 200 cigarettes each.

The cigarettes lacked the required health warnings in Greek and Turkish, security markings and traceability codes, indicating that they had not been legally cleared for duty.

The tobacco products and the vehicle were impounded. The driver was arrested and later released after agreeing to pay an out-of-court fine of €3,600 and €400 for the return of the vehicle.

Hookah tobacco found in luggage

Later on Wednesday, customs officers stopped a Turkish Cypriot taxi carrying an Israeli passenger travelling to Larnaca Airport.

A search of the passenger’s luggage found four one-kilogram packages of hookah tobacco without the required markings.

The passenger was released after paying an out-of-court fine of €1,400.
